What is an Ambulatory Blood Pressure Monitor?

A portable blood pressure monitor worn on a belt or strap that automatically measures your blood pressure at regular intervals over 24 hours. A cuff on your upper arm inflates and deflates throughout the day and night while you go about your normal activities. No radiation. No needles. No sedation.

📊

Why has my doctor referred me?

  • • To confirm a diagnosis of high blood pressure (hypertension)
  • • To detect "white coat" hypertension — high readings only in the clinic
  • • To check how well your blood pressure medication is working
  • • To assess your blood pressure pattern over a full day and night

What happens — Step by Step

1
🚶

Arrive & check in

You will be welcomed by our staff and taken to a private room to have the monitor fitted.

2
💪

Cuff fitted

A blood pressure cuff is wrapped around your upper arm and connected to a small recorder worn on a belt or strap.

3
💨

Cuff inflates automatically

The cuff will inflate at set intervals — usually every 20–30 minutes during the day and every 30–60 minutes at night.

4
🚿

Keep the device dry

Continue your normal daily activities, but do not shower, bathe or swim while wearing the monitor.

5
↩️

Return the monitor

After 24 hours, return the device to the clinic so the recording can be analysed.

After the test — no risks, no downtime

  • • No recovery time needed — some people get mild skin irritation from the cuff pressure
  • • A specialist will review your recording and send a report to your doctor within 7 working days
